Veterans in Arkansas

Arkansas is home to more than 222,000 veterans.  That equals close to 10% of our adult population. Opioid Awareness

It is estimated that 225 people die every day from a drug overdose in America. In 2020, 547 people died from a drug overdose in Arkansas.The current opioid epidemic is one of the deadliest drug epidemics in our history. Suicide Prevention Month

According to the Arkansas Department of Health, suicide is the leading cause of violent death in Arkansas. In 2020, 583 Arkansans died by suicide.That same year, close to 46,000 individuals died by suicide nationwide. That is one death every 11 minutes. Hunger Action Month

It is estimated that more than 20 percent of Arkansas households are food insecure. The Arkansas Hunger Relief Alliance also estimates that 1 in 3 children in the state are facing food insecurity. Labor Day 2022

The State Capitol Offices and all State Buildings will be closed on Monday, Sept. 5, 2022, to observe Labor Day. A legal holiday by authority of Act 304 of 2001 and amended by Act 561 of 2017.
